Matthews Aurora Funeral Solutions is one of the largest manufacturers of caskets and funerary urns in the United States, selling over 38% of the country's caskets as of 2005. The Aurora, Indiana–based company is a subsidiary of Pittsburgh-based Matthews International. The company makes both wooden and metal caskets and urns for holding cremated remains. It also provides supplies and consulting services for funeral homes.
Movado is a luxury American watch brand originally founded in 1881 in Switzerland. Movado means "movement" in Esperanto. The watches are known for their signature metallic dot at 12 o'clock and minimalist style; the company is best known for its Museum Watch.
